Their popularity stems from 2 main sources.
EDIT:
1) Not DOA speed clearers, but PVPers exactly for the -2 health/degen on 1 hand weaps.
2) Collectors. The -1's seem to be the least abundant of all OS mods.
Price wise it's as high as is it currently simply because of the DOA's. Up until the DOA dual vamp boom, you could find r9 dual vamps for 5-10k+ on common skins, and obviously more on desired skins, but still less than half of what it is currently.
Recently, rarer or more sought after r9 dual vamps hit around 100e. This excludes ultra rare skins cuz I haven't even seen dual vamps on some of them and they could command some interesting bids. The longsword, as nice as it is, is still a common skin that has many collectors.
So as long as DOA sc'ers need them, you can get 35e+ imo. BUT if that trend dies down, collectors won't be nearly as eager to pay that much.
I have a dual vamp (wingblade) that hasn't received a single bid in a few days. The skin isn't as popular, but usually some doa'er will bid on any dual vamp and try to buy it after a day or 2.
